What Causes the Color of Steak?
The color of a steak is primarily determined by its myoglobin content, a protein found in muscle tissue responsible for storing oxygen. Myoglobin's state (whether oxygenated or deoxygenated) influences the meat's color, leading to the familiar shades of red, purple, or brown. Several factors affect these color variations:
- Animal Species: Different animals have varying levels of myoglobin, affecting meat color. Beef tends to be bright red, while pork is usually pink, and lamb has a darker hue.
- Age of the Animal: Older animals often have higher myoglobin levels, resulting in darker meat.
- Cut of Meat: Muscle groups with more activity tend to be darker due to increased myoglobin content.
- Post-Mortem Changes: When an animal is slaughtered, the meat undergoes chemical changes that influence color, such as the conversion of myoglobin to metmyoglobin, which causes browning.
- Storage and Handling: Improper storage can cause oxidation, leading to discoloration.
Is the Red Color of Steak Natural?
Generally, the vibrant red color seen in fresh beef steaks is natural and a result of myoglobin. When exposed to oxygen, myoglobin binds to oxygen molecules, turning bright redโa color often associated with freshness. This process is called oxymyoglobin formation and is a natural phenomenon that occurs when meat is exposed to air.
However, the color can vary depending on several factors, including the age of the animal, the cut, and how the meat has been handled. For example, meat that has been vacuum-sealed often appears darker due to reduced oxygen exposure, which keeps myoglobin in the deoxygenated form (purple or dark red). When the package is opened and exposed to air, the meat often brightens in color within a short time.
Does Meat Color Indicate Freshness or Quality?
Many consumers mistakenly believe that bright red meat always indicates freshness or high quality. While color can be a helpful visual cue, it is not a definitive measure of freshness or safety. Meat can be fresh and safe to eat even if it appears darker or browner, especially after proper storage.
Key indicators of freshness include:
- Odor: Fresh meat should have a mild, clean smell. A sour or off odor indicates spoilage.
- Texture: Firmness and elasticity are signs of fresh meat.
- Color: While color can be helpful, it should be considered alongside other factors.
Why Do Some Steaks Look Unusual? Is It Dyeing?
In some cases, steaks may appear unnaturally bright or have unusual hues, prompting concerns about artificial coloring. Here are some reasons for abnormal colorations:
- Use of Artificial Colorants: Some meat products, especially processed or packaged meats, may contain added colorings to enhance appearance or compensate for discoloration. However, in many countries, the use of artificial dyes in fresh meat is strictly regulated or prohibited.
- Packaging Methods: Vacuum-sealing or modified atmosphere packaging can change the meat's appearance, sometimes causing a darker or more vibrant look without any dyeing involved.
- Meat Treatments: Certain treatments, such as carbon monoxide packaging, help maintain a bright red color by forming carboxymyoglobin, which stabilizes the color. These methods are approved and considered safe but can give the impression of artificially enhanced color.
Is There Any Dyeing of Steak in the Food Industry?
In most developed countries, the use of artificial dyes directly in fresh meat is heavily regulated. The primary goal is to ensure consumer safety and transparency. While some processed meat products, like sausages or deli meats, may contain approved food colorants, fresh steaks are generally not dyed intentionally.
However, some practices involve the use of approved preservatives or treatments that can influence the appearance of meat without being classified as dyes. For example:
- Carbon Monoxide Packaging: This method involves exposing meat to a small amount of carbon monoxide to form carboxymyoglobin, which stabilizes the bright red color and extends shelf life. This practice is permitted in certain countries and is considered safe when used within regulatory limits.
- Oxidation and Natural Processes: Oxygen exposure naturally influences meat color, sometimes making it appear more vibrant or darker, depending on storage conditions.
It is important to note that these treatments are regulated and disclosed on packaging labels in many jurisdictions, promoting transparency and consumer confidence.
How to Identify If a Steak Has Been Dyed or Treated?
Consumers concerned about artificial coloring can take specific steps to determine whether a steak has been dyed or treated:
- Check Packaging Labels: Look for disclosures about treatments such as carbon monoxide or other preservatives. Reputable brands will disclose any such treatments.
- Observe the Color: Natural meat typically has a consistent, slightly uneven coloring. An unnaturally bright, uniform red might indicate treatments like carbon monoxide packaging.
- Smell and Texture: Always assess freshness through smell and texture, as visual cues alone can be misleading.
- Buy from Trusted Sources: Purchase meat from reputable butchers or stores known for transparency and high-quality standards.
Are There Any Health Concerns Related to Dyed or Treated Meat?
Most approved treatments, including carbon monoxide packaging, are considered safe by food safety authorities when used within regulatory limits. These methods are designed to preserve quality and extend shelf life without posing health risks.
However, concerns may arise if consumers unknowingly purchase meat treated with unapproved or illegal substances. Therefore, purchasing from reputable sources and reading labels is crucial. If in doubt, consumers can contact local food safety agencies for information about permissible treatments and additives in their region.
